Value of Microsoft Gain Access To in Your Organization
Mid to big companies could have hundreds to countless desktop computers. Each desktop has conventional software application that allows team to achieve computing jobs without the intervention of the company's IT division. This provides the primary tenet of desktop computer computer: empowering users to raise performance as well as reduced costs via decentralized computer.
As the world's most preferred desktop data source, Microsoft Access is utilized in mostly all companies that use Microsoft Windows. As individuals come to be much more proficient in the operation of these applications, they start to recognize solutions to organisation jobs that they themselves could apply. The all-natural evolution of this process is that spreadsheets and databases are created and also kept by end-users to handle their day-to-day tasks.
This dynamic enables both performance and also dexterity as users are equipped to address company issues without the treatment of their organization's Infotech framework. Microsoft Access suits this space by offering a desktop database atmosphere where end-users can promptly create data source applications with tables, queries, forms as well as records. Access is excellent for low-priced solitary user or workgroup data source applications.
However this power comes with a rate. As more customers utilize Microsoft Access to manage their work, problems of information security, integrity, maintainability, scalability and management end up being intense. Individuals who built these remedies are rarely trained to be database professionals, developers or system managers. As databases outgrow the abilities of the original author, they should relocate into a much more robust setting.
While some people consider this a reason that end-users should not ever utilize Microsoft Gain access to, we consider this to be the exemption instead of the rule. The majority of Microsoft Gain access to data sources are created by end-users and also never should finish to the following level. Carrying out a strategy to produce every end-user data source "properly" would certainly be a massive waste of resources.
For the unusual Microsoft Gain access to databases that are so successful that they need to develop, SQL Server provides the next all-natural progression. Without shedding the existing financial investment in the application (table designs, information, questions, types, records, macros and modules), information can be relocated to SQL Server and also the Access database connected to it. As Soon As in SQL Server, other systems such as Aesthetic Studio.NET can be used to create Windows, internet and/or mobile services. The Access database application may be entirely replaced or a crossbreed remedy could be developed.
To find out more, review our paper Microsoft Access within an Organization's General Database Approach.
Microsoft Access and SQL Database Architectures
Microsoft Accessibility is the premier desktop data source product readily available for Microsoft Windows. Because its intro in 1992, Access has given a flexible system for novices and also power users to produce single-user and also small workgroup database applications.
Microsoft Accessibility has appreciated fantastic success because it originated the concept of stepping users via a difficult task with using Wizards. This, in addition to an user-friendly question developer, one of the best desktop coverage devices and also the inclusion of macros and also a coding environment, all add to making Gain access to the most effective option for desktop computer database growth.
Given that Accessibility is designed to be easy to use and also friendly, it was never ever meant as a platform for the most reliable and durable applications. As a whole, upsizing must occur when these qualities become important for the application. The good news is, the versatility of Gain access to enables you to upsize to SQL Server in a range of ways, from a fast cost-effective, data-moving situation to full application redesign.
Gain access to gives a rich range of information designs that enable it to take care of information in a variety of means. When thinking about an upsizing project, it is important to recognize the range of means Gain access to may be set up to use its native Jet database format and also SQL Server in both single and also multi-user atmospheres.
Accessibility as well as the Jet Engine
Microsoft Access has its very own data source engine-- the Microsoft Jet Data source Engine (additionally called the ACE with Gain access to 2007's intro of the ACCDB format). Jet was designed from the starting to support solitary user and multiuser file sharing on a computer network. Data sources have a maximum dimension of 2 GB, although an Access database can attach to other databases via linked tables and also numerous backend databases to workaround the 2 GB restriction.
However Accessibility is more than a database engine. It is additionally an application advancement atmosphere that permits users to create questions, develop forms as well as records, and also create macros and Aesthetic Fundamental for Applications (VBA) component code to automate an application. In its default configuration, Gain access to makes use of Jet internally to store its design things such as kinds, reports, macros, and also components as have a peek at this site well as uses Jet to store all table information.
One of the primary benefits of Accessibility upsizing is that you could revamp your application to remain to utilize its forms, reports, macros and also modules, and change the Jet Engine with SQL Server. This enables the very best of both worlds: the simplicity of use of Accessibility with the integrity and safety and security of SQL Server.
Prior to you try to convert an Access database to SQL Server, see to it you understand:
Which applications belong in Microsoft Gain access to vs. SQL Server? Not every database needs to be modified.
The reasons for upsizing your data source. Ensure SQL Server gives you just what you look for.
The tradeoffs for doing so. There are pluses and minuses depending upon what you're attempting to enhance. Ensure you are not migrating to SQL Server exclusively for performance factors.
In a lot of cases, performance lowers when an application is upsized, especially for reasonably small databases (under 200 MEGABYTES).
Some performance issues are unassociated to the backend database. Poorly made inquiries and table layout will not be repaired by upsizing. Microsoft Access tables use some functions that SQL Server tables do not such as an automated refresh when the information changes. SQL Server requires an explicit requery.
Options for Migrating Microsoft Accessibility to SQL Server
There are numerous options for hosting SQL Server databases:
A regional instance of SQL Express, which is a cost-free version of SQL Server can be set up on each user's device
A shared SQL Server data source on your network
A cloud host such as SQL Azure. Cloud hosts have security that limitation which IP addresses could obtain data, so set IP addresses and/or VPN is needed.
There are lots of ways to upsize your Microsoft Access databases to SQL Server:
Move the data to SQL Server and also connect to it from your Access database while protecting the existing Access application.
Adjustments could be had to sustain SQL Server queries as well as distinctions from Gain access to databases.
Transform a Gain access to MDB database to an Access Data Task (ADP) that attaches straight to a SQL Server data source.
Since ADPs were deprecated in Gain access to 2013, we do not recommend this option.
Usage Microsoft Gain Access To with MS Azure.
With Office365, your information is uploaded right into a SQL Server database organized by SQL Azure with an Accessibility Internet front end
Proper for standard watching as well as modifying of data throughout the internet
Regrettably, Gain Access To Internet Apps do not have the modification features similar to VBA in Access desktop solutions
Migrate the whole application to the.NET Structure, ASP.NET, and also SQL Server system, or recreate it on SharePoint.
A hybrid service that puts the information in SQL Server with one more front-end plus an Access front-end data source.
SQL Server can be the conventional version held on a venture top quality web server or a complimentary SQL Server Express version set up on your COMPUTER
Database Difficulties in an Organization
Every company has to overcome data source challenges to meet their objective. These difficulties include:
• Maximizing roi
• Handling human resources
• Rapid release
• Flexibility and also maintainability
• Scalability (second).
Taking Full Advantage Of Roi.
Taking full advantage of return on investment is a lot more important compared to ever before. Management demands concrete results for the pricey investments in data source application advancement. Numerous data source development initiatives cannot generate the outcomes they assure. Picking the appropriate Read More Here technology and also strategy for every degree in an organization is crucial to taking full advantage of roi. This indicates selecting the best overall return, which does not imply selecting the least pricey preliminary remedy. This is commonly one of the most essential choice a primary info police officer (CIO) or primary innovation policeman (CTO) makes.
Taking Care Of Human Resources.
Taking care of individuals to tailor innovation is challenging. The even more complex the technology or application, the fewer individuals are certified to handle it, and also the much more pricey they are to work with. Turnover is constantly a concern, as well as having the right criteria is critical to successfully supporting heritage applications. Training as well as staying up to date with modern technology are likewise challenging.
Producing database applications swiftly is important, not just for minimizing costs, however, for responding to internal or consumer demands. The ability to develop applications swiftly supplies a significant competitive advantage.
The IT supervisor is responsible for offering options and making tradeoffs to support the business requirements of the organization. By utilizing different technologies, you could offer service decision manufacturers selections, such as a 60 percent remedy in three months, a 90 percent solution in twelve months, or a 99 percent service in twenty-four months. (Rather than months, it could be bucks.) Sometimes, time to market is most critical, various other times it could be price, as well as other times attributes have a peek here or protection are most important. Requirements change quickly and also are unpredictable. We stay in a "good enough" as opposed to a best world, so recognizing ways to deliver "sufficient" options quickly provides you and also your organization an one-upmanship.
Adaptability and Maintainability.
Despite the most effective system layout, by the time multiple month advancement efforts are finished, requires adjustment. Variations adhere to variations, as well as a system that's made to be adaptable and also able to fit adjustment can mean the difference between success and failure for the users' occupations.
Systems needs to be created to handle the expected data and more. Yet many systems are never finished, are thrown out soon, or alter a lot with time that the first analyses are wrong. Scalability is necessary, yet often lesser compared to a fast service. If the application efficiently sustains development, scalability can be included later on when it's financially warranted.